Family of Six Reported Dead as Harvey Continues to Pummel Texas

As Hurricane Harvey continues to pummel Houston and southeastern Texas, the death toll is rising along with floodwaters across the state.

So far, there have been reports of at least 11 deaths, eight of which were confirmed by authorities to the Washington Post. That number appears to include a family of six who were presumed drowned in northeast Houston Monday after the van they were traveling in was swept away by floodwaters, local TV news station KHOU reports.

Across Texas, experts and government officials anticipate that with another 20 inches of rainfall expected over the next week, things will likely get much worse. And it's not just Hurricane Harve —on Monday, the National Weather Service issued a tornado watch for part of southeastern Texas and most of the coastal region of Louisiana.
